my first saas. i think i built something people actually want and completely failed at the business side. would genuinely love help. openpaper ( writes full, cited research papers from a prompt. research, outline, writing, real citations, export. the honest numbers: - ~2,300 signups - ~1,500 generated a full paper. people actually use it. - ~5 have ever paid. ~$45/mo. activation is great, revenue is basically zero. i've been staring at this for weeks. the paywall is on export (pay ~$12 to download the pdf). but the full cited paper is right there on screen, free, you can read it and copy-paste it. so i'm charging for the gift wrap after handing over the gift. almost nobody even reaches checkout. 76% generate exactly one paper and leave. one-and-done, so subscriptions make no sense. the audience is mostly students and researchers on personal gmail, all over the world, almost none on university or company emails. traffic is x and github. so i genuinely can't tell
